Children’s Day arrives every year on November 14th in India. That date marks the birthday of Jawaharlal Nehru, the country’s first Prime Minister. Children called him Chacha Nehru, which means Uncle Nehru. He loved children with his whole heart. He believed they were the future of the nation. He once said that children are like buds in a garden. They need careful nurturing, not harsh lectures. They need love, not fear. They need encouragement, not criticism.
